Fake service dogs laws have been in hot water in recent months. Many states have passed legislation to curb these illegal practices. It is illegal to use a pet animal as a service animal under the Americans with Disabilities Act, but it is often enforced. 31 states have banned the representation of pets as service animals, and five others have criminalized some aspect.

Fake service dogs are illegal. But how do you catch one? Although the American with Disabilities Act (ADA) makes misrepresenting a service dog illegal, enforcement is difficult, and the laws protect privacy.
